2Q08 Malaysia Mobile Forecast, 2008 - 2010: Celcom to lose market share to Maxis and DiGi.com in Malaysia’s wireless operator space

IEMR’s Mobile Forecast on Malaysia provides over 65 operational and financial metrics for the Malaysia wireless market. We cover quarterly historical data starting in 4Q2003 and ending in 4Q2007. We also provide four-year forecasts at the operator level going out to 2010. Operators covered for Malaysia include: Maxis, Celcom, and DiGi.Com. Our Mobile Forecasts are updated quarterly and are available for one-time delivery or through regular updates.

Notable highlights of the 2Q08 Malaysia Mobile Forecast include:
  • The wireless penetration level in Malaysia will continue to increase and will reach 96.8% in 2010.
  • The level of market concentration in Malaysia, as measured by the HHI index, will stay the same over the next several years. However, we expect that Celcom will be losing subscribers to Maxis and DiGi.Com. We forecast that Celcom’s market share will drop from 30.2% to 28.4% while that of DiGi.Com will increase from 28.6% to 29.8% over the forecast period from 2008 to 2010.
  • The number of subscribers in Malaysia will increase from our projected 25.0 million in 2008 to our forecasted 28.1 million in 2010. In the process, operators will enjoy high subscriber growth rates. Maxis, Celcom and DiGi.Com will have subscriber growth of 14.2%, 5.9% and 17.2% respectively over the forecast period of 2008 - 2010.
  • In 2010, Maxis will receive the highest ARPU of US$ 21.76 per month while DiGi.Com will receive the lowest ARPU in the country at US$18.96 per month.
